The History of Tesla In 2003, Martin eberhard and Mark Tapenning founded Tesla Corporation.
In 2004, elon musk invested $6.3 million in Tesla and became the CEO of Tesla.

In 2009, Tesla was affected by the global financial crisis. Daimler bought 9% of Tesla's shares and injected 50 million US dollars into Tesla. The US Department of Energy also hoped that Tesla would issue 465 million US dollars of low-interest loans, so that Tesla did not go bankrupt.
